Juvenile oyster survival sharply declined at shrimp densities of 50–100 shrimp m² through sediment reworking burying the oysters (Willapa Bay). This result informs commercial harvest strategies and management of vulnerable oyster populations bit.ly/meps_758_61

Juvenile oyster survival sharply declined at shrimp densities of 50–100 shrimp m² through sediment reworking burying the oysters (Willapa Bay). This result informs commercial harvest strategies and management of vulnerable oyster populations

We characterized neonatal growth patterns in harbour seal pups in the St. Lawrence Estuary. We found that neonatal growth is nonlinear. Males are born heavier than females and large pups at birth tend to gain more mass than small pups bit.ly/meps_761_129

We characterized neonatal growth patterns in harbour seal pups in the St. Lawrence Estuary. We found that neonatal growth is nonlinear. Males are born heavier than females and large pups at birth tend to gain more mass than small pups

White sharks are on the rise in Atlantic Canadian waters! Our new study reveals an increase in their presence since 2019, with migration probabilities up to 3.7x higher and their seasonal stay extending by over 20 days bit.ly/meps_761_145

White sharks are on the rise in Atlantic Canadian waters! Our new study reveals an increase in their presence since 2019, with migration probabilities up to 3.7x higher and their seasonal stay extending by over 20 days
